The present invention relates to a method of manufacturing a multilayer ceramic capacitor, having the steps of: (a) alternately layering internal electrodes and ceramic green sheets containing a ceramic material having barium titanate to form a laminated body; (b) sintering the laminated body to obtain a sintered body; and (c) forming an external electrode on end faces of the sintered body to obtain a multilayer ceramic capacitor. The barium titanate has a diffraction line derived from (002) plane and a diffraction line derived from (200) plane in an X-ray diffraction chart. The ratio I(200)/Ib of peak intensity I(200) at 2(200) to diffraction intensity Ib at a midpoint angle between peak angle 2(002) of the diffraction line derived from the (002) plane and peak angle 2(200) of the diffraction line derived from the (200) plane is 2 to 10. The product rSa of mean particle size r (m) of the barium titanate and specific surface area Sa (m2/g) is 1 to 2.
